What Is Residential Window Tinting?

This process involves applying polyester film to the surface of the window. This allows only certain types of light rays to pass through the window into the home.


This also helps regulate the amount of heat in rooms with tinted windows. Advancements in this technology have made residential window tinting an affordable, attractive improvement you can make to your home.

UV Protection

Many people overlook the UV protection capabilities that window tinting provides. Unfortunately, UV rays that pass through glass can still be harmful.

It's even recommended to wear sunscreen if you work in a room that has sun-facing windows. Since tinted windows reflect UV rays, they can also prevent your furniture from becoming sun damaged.

Types of Window Tint

Before you make a decision, consider the available types of window tint. There are different choices for different use cases. Let's explore them in detail.

Solar

This type of film aims to block the maximum amount of heat. It's most popular among homeowners who live in areas with sunny climates.

So, it's not uncommon to see solar-tinted windows in states like Florida, Arizona, Texas, or California. Solar film is also the most common type of window tint. Since it provides a dark, modern appearance, many people choose to install it simply for its aesthetic appeal.

Decorative

Decorative tint doesn't have as much utility as other options, but it can be a great way to improve the appearance of your home. You also don't have to modify or replace existing glass. Those looking for a low-end option that provides great results should consider this choice.

Security

Security film adheres to glass and holds fragments together if the window breaks. So, if someone tried to break into your home, the glass wouldn't shatter into pieces.


This can also be great during storms, as high winds that hurl objects toward your home won't shatter your windows. Security film isn't overly common, but it provides an amazing amount of utility.
